Tucked away in a quiet part of North Hollywood Park lies a memorial to the 78 Californians who lost their lives in the terrorist attacks of Sept. 11, 2001.
The memorial was dedicated on Sept. 11, 2002, by the Hollywood Beatification Team and has been a frequent site of ceremonies on the anniversary of the attacks. Every Californian who died is listed on a plaque flanked by white flowers, trees and four concrete benches.
